New foreign exchange law is in force in Brazil

In Brazil, the new foreign exchange law passed at the end of 2021 came into force on December 31, 2022, after regulation by the central bank and the National Monetary Council (CMN). 

According to the central bank, the new law is based on the free movement of capital and the reduction of bureaucracy in foreign exchange market transactions.
